www.australian24.com
>
liftshop.com.au
SORT BY KEYS
SORT BY NAME
Add Your Listing
Advertisement
Lift Shop | Australia39;s No 1 for Luxury Home Lifts | Multi-Award Winning Home Elevator Specialis
Clicks: 148, website added: Nov 3, 2013
Lift Shop | Australia39;s No 1 for Luxury Home Lifts | Multi-Award Winning Home Elevator Specialis
LINK
:
liftshop.com.au
Country:
Australia
Description:
Home Page, shortcut key=1